Programozható logikai tömbök - a digitális áramkörök
Az FPGA-k széles körben használják az építőiparban különféle bonyolult és képességeit a digitális eszközök, mint például:
Programozható logikai tömb (PLA)
Modern elektronikai ipar széles skáláját gyártja a speciális LSI felhasználásra nem szabványos digitális berendezések. Ilyen LSI-k váltották használt besorolási kritériumait az ügyfél részvétele a végrehajtása speciális funkciók (1.).
Egyedi IC alapján kialakított szabványos vagy egyedi tervezésű elemek és kapcsolataik a működési diagramja az ügyfél. Topológiai rétegek ASIC tervezték és gyártották egyéni fényképet maszkok, amely lehetővé teszi, hogy elérjük a határait műszaki paraméterek ebben a technológiában. Egyedi LSI is tervezhetők standard elemeket, amelyek egy része a könyvtár, amely magában foglalhatja mind a logikai kapu (ÉS - NEM, vagy - nem, kiváltja), és bonyolultabb (összeadókat, szorzók, aritmetikai-logikai eszköz).
Szerint luzakaznye BIS áll előre megtervezett gyártója által az állandó. Amikor LSI BK szakirányú érjük a végső szakaszában a termelés alkalmazásával váltakozó rétegeiből összeköttetések. FPGA eljuttatni a fogyasztóhoz a szerkezetileg kész formában és programozás történik elektromosan.
PLA - található a kristály mátrixban az azonos típusú ÉS és VAGY elemeket, amely vegyület oly módon hajtjuk végre, hogy érvényesíteni előre meghatározott funkciók MDNF. A folyamat a kötőelemek nevezett programozási PLA PLA.
PLA osztva a következő:
- maszk PLA, ha programozva a gyártó által egy speciálisan kialakított fotomaszkba;
- egyfelhasználós programozható fogyasztói keresztül különleges biztosítékot olvadékony paplanok;
- többször programozható fogyasztói elektromos felvétel és UV vagy elektromosan törölhető.
Programozási végzik a felhasználók által az önálló programozók mikroprocesszor és moduláris PC-alapú programozók.
Egy tipikus PLA ábrán bemutatott struktúrának. 1.

M1 mátrix végrehajtja a szükséges összefüggésben, és ha azt akarjuk kapcsolni az M1-mátrix telepítve a kereszteződésekben a dióda. A dióda lehetővé teszi a galvanikus kapcsolat a sorban vonal, amelynek a megfelelő változó, és a függőleges busszal rendelkezik a szükséges összefüggésben. Ha egy ilyen kapcsolat nem szükséges, a dióda égett. Ennek eredményeképpen, nincs dióda és a változó nem vesz részt a kialakulását a összefüggésben.
Ellenállások R1, R2, R3, R4, R5 biztosít átfolyó áram a dióda a megfelelő tranzisztor bázis és a megjelenése potenciálok.
M2 mátrix kollektív tulajdon és úgy van programozva, hogy a szervezet szükséges DNF. Metszéspontjában a mátrix meghatározott p-n típusú tranzisztorok, amelyek szintén programozható. Jellemzően a emitterkapcsolásban e tranzisztor van egy ellenállás, amely alatt elégetett programozás. Ennek eredményeként, a kapcsolat a vízszintes és függőleges busz elveszett.
Amikor beállítja az kötőjelek jelenlétét jelzi linkeket a mátrixban M2, azaz. „/” A rendszer azt jelenti, hogy ezeket a részeket a mátrix a tranzisztorok.
Amikor a tranzisztor bekapcsolt, illetve R6, R7 vagy R8 jelenik jelentkezzen. 1 és válik a valódi funkciója a megfelelő y1 -Y3-.
Tekintettel arra, hogy minden Boole-függvény lehet képviselve PDNF amely azután minimalizálható, programozási logika tömb lehetővé teszi az építési bármilyen kombinációja a mátrix áramkör, amely nem a memóriában. A rendszer csak akkor működik, ha a bemeneti jelek és tárolja az előző állapot.
A hátránya az áramkör a lehetetlensége átprogramozás.